Specifications
| Pieces included | 4 pieces (2 blades, 1 mid shaft, 1 T-handle) |
| Shaft material | Aluminium alloy (reinforced) |
| Blade material | PP + fiberglass |
| Weight | Approximately 2.13 lb (968 g) |
| Adjustable length | 68 in to 85 in (175 cm to 215 cm) |
| Locking system | Double ABS with 304 stainless steel screws |

Frequently Asked Questions
Does this paddle float if dropped?
Yes, the PP + fiberglass blades are designed to float so the paddle will remain on the surface in fresh and salt water.
How long does assembly take?
The 4-piece design with the ABS locking and stainless screws can be assembled in a few seconds once parts are aligned correctly.
Is the length easy to adjust on the water?
The laser scale and double ABS locking make on-the-water adjustments possible, but users should ensure the locking screws are tightened to prevent rotation.
